I know, but the guns that have that are usually weaker. Like the Carrier has less base value than most other assault rifles, but it makes up for it in the bonus projectiles. Meanwhile Yellowcake does more damage than most other heavies, and still gets that added bonus?

What about the Pimpernel in BL2? The card shows a single damage stat, but it has 5 extra pellets that each can apply the original damage plus 50% extra damage when it hits again. Not too much different from the YC tbh
The YC doesn’t do a lot of damage on a direct hit in my experience - it’s the secondary damage that causes all the havoc but often if I score a direct hit on eg a boss enemy and I get the range wrong I barely tickle them.
